Open seven days a week, the skating rink at Lloyd Center mall offers a convenient chance to get on the ice. As a bonus, you can get some Christmas shopping done while the kids have fun! The rink has been a hot spot in Portland since it opened in 1960, but beautiful renovations in the last couple years have ensured it’s continuing success. This year, they’re performing enhanced cleaning services and offering reserved time slots for 60 minute skating sessions (masks required).

This is the rink that Portland’s own Winterhawks glide onto-- with some extra luck you might even see a player! This official regulation-size rink is a practice space for the team, and also open for pint-sized skater practice. Along with open skate, you can choose from plenty of classes for hockey and beyond, or swing by the pro shop for extra ice gear (or Christmas presents!).
